Tarleton State University

Tarleton State University is a public research university in Stephenville, Texas, United States. It is a founding member of the Texas A&M University System and enrolled over 15,000 students... Wikipedia

  • Former names:  The John Tarleton College, (1899–1917), John Tarleton Agricultural College, (1917–1949), Tarleton State College, (1949–1973)
  • Type:  Public research university
  • Established:  September 7, 1899
  • Parent institution:  Texas A&M University System
  • Endowment:  $42 million (2016)
  • President:  James L. Hurley
  • Students:  14,092 (fall 2022)
  • Undergraduates:  12,012
  • Postgraduates:  2,080
  • Campus:  Urban, 1,973 acres
  • Colors:  Purple & white
